OKR template to implement a swift 3-day surgery scheduling system after order submission
Your OKR template
The goal aims to bring down the average time to schedule surgeries by about 70% post order submission. For this purpose, the staff would be trained on quick order processing methods. The patient pre-surgery procedures will be streamlined for immediacy, apart from incorporating an effective automated scheduling software.
The OKR further has an objective to attain a 95% customer satisfaction rate with regards to the surgery scheduling time. This will be achieved by conducting regular patient surveys about their satisfaction with the schedule. The scheduling system will be upgraded to make it easily accessible. In addition, training will be conducted for the staff on scheduling efficiency.
Achieving these goals will lead to better and more efficient patient care by ensuring that surgeries are scheduled in a timely and less hassle manner. This, in turn, will greatly enhance the customer experience which is a priority for any healthcare organization.
ObjectiveImplement a swift 3-day surgery scheduling system after order submission
KRTrain all relevant staff on the new scheduling system within the first month
Implement follow-up assessments post-training
Identify relevant staff for new scheduling system training
Schedule training sessions for identified staff
KRReduce the average time to schedule surgeries by 70% after order submission
Train staff on rapid order processing techniques
Streamline patient pre-surgery procedures
Implement efficient, automated scheduling software
KRAchieve a 95% customer satisfaction rate regarding the surgery scheduling time
Survey patients regularly regarding their schedule satisfaction
Streamline scheduling system for easier access
Implement training for staff about scheduling efficiency
